Sherri took over a decade to write her debut novel, primarily because life intervened.  With a spouse and three daughters, something always needed to give and that thing was often her book.  Hear how being a finalist in the 2015 Rising Star contest through WFWA helped her hone her manuscript through feedback from agents, urging her to change the novel's structure from a chronological one to one that utilized flashbacks to tell the dual-timeline story.  Her controversial ending scared off several agents but appealed to her eventual publisher, Red Adept. Sherri Leimkuhler has written professionally for more than twenty years but is a Jill of many trades, with experience in sales, marketing, aviation, and yoga instruction. Her health-and-fitness column, "For the Fun of Fit," appeared bi-weekly in the Carroll County Times for nearly a decade. A competitive triathlete and two-time Ironman finisher, Sherri also enjoys reading, hiking, paddle boarding, trail running, traveling, and wine tasting. Sherri lives in Maryland with her husband, three daughters, and two Labrador retrievers.  To learn more about Sherri, click here.
